A firm mattress with a supportive box spring is usually the best choice for people who suffer from chronic back discomfort. Most experts agree that a very soft mattress can aggravate pain in your back. Firm mattresses tend to be better on the back; however, if one is too firm it could also add to back discomfort. You may need to try out many mattresses before finding the one that is right for you.

Talk a walk when you have a break in order to protect your back if you spend long hours at a desk. When you stretch your leg muscles via standing and walking, you are also stretching out your back muscles. This can help alleviate any compression issues and back pain that occur from sitting too long.

Many of the simplest methods of treating back pain are often the most effective. Avoid exertion for a couple of days. If your back begs for quick relief, taking an anti-inflammatory pain medication, such as naproxen sodium or ibuprofen, helps a little. You can further relieve the pain in your back by using heat or cold.
Although many people believe otherwise, people who have back pain must exercise frequently. While someone suffering from back pain may worry that exercise will make it worse, the opposite is true. Stretching and flexing the muscles and tendons in the back will ease your pain.
